Bradley teen escapees recaptured in Dalton

CLEVELAND, Tennessee (WDEF) – Those two 16-year olds who broke out of the Bradley county juvenile detention center last Friday have been captured.

The Bradley County Sheriff’s Office and the Cleveland Police Department announced today that Memphis Smith and Abraham Augustin were arrested just before noon at a gas station on Connector 3 in Dalton.

That followed their armed carjacking on McCutchen Rd in Chattanooga early this morning.

In addition to the original charges of attempted first-degree murder and aggravated rape, both juveniles will now face charges of felony escape and felony auto theft out of Bradley County.
